automaker

noun
au·​to·​mak·​er | \ ˈȯ-tō-ˌmā-kər How to pronounce automaker (audio) , ˈä-tō-\

Definition of automaker

: a manufacturer of automobiles

First Known Use of automaker

1899, in the meaning defined above
